D5244t11 injector torque wrench settings
Hi all,
Noticed a bit of a whiff of diesel when the car starts, so had a rummage and 3 of the injectors are wet, thought I'd see if I could get away with nipping them up and found the bolts seemed very loose, I can't find the torque wrench setting anywhere. Anybody got any ideas what it should be? I've done them up to 15nm for now, which was about 4 complete turns, just to give you an idea. Cheers, Paul. |

Evening , from memory the injector bolts are one time use DO NOT re-tighten them .
If the injectors are wet , firstly check the spill return pipes are not the cause of the fuel leak . These are the fabric ( from original ) that run across the top of the injectors and with time / heat & vibrations they degrade & dribble . If you do decide to tighten the injector bolts again do not , buy a set of spring clamps & new bolts . Clean the thread hole with a tap to remove any junk that might cause the bolt to bind as it is tightened & wash out with brake cleaner , allowing it to dry before shoving bolt back . early engine I think are 28 Nm (21 Ftlb ) torque setting & later are only 13 Nm (9.5 Ftlb ) .
